BENEFITS OF POMEGRANATE

  The pomegranate is a fruit-bearing deciduous shrub in the family Lythraceae, subfamily Punicoideae, that grows between 5 and 10 m tall.   Pomegranates are rich in antioxidants and flavonoids, both of which are known to prevent free radicals from damaging your cells. In some studies, pomegranates show potential to be effective in preventing prostate, breast, lung, and colon cancers.   Pomegranates contain 14g of sugar per 100g, but don't let that put you off too much. 100g of pomegranates also contains 7g of fibre, 3g of protein, and 30 per cent of the recommended daily amount of vitamin C. Just don't eat too much.   Pomegranate seeds and juice are both sweet and tart in flavor. Like citrus fruit, pomegranates taste very refreshing and can be bold in flavor. Regular consumption of pomegranate helps in improving gut health, digestion, and keep bowel diseases at bay. SEVEN WONDERS OF ANCIENT WORLD

The seven wonders of the ancient world have been celebrated by scholars, writers, and artists since at least 200 B.C. These marvels of architecture, like Egypt's pyramids, were monuments of human achievement, built by Mediterranean and Middle Eastern empires of their day with little more than crude tools and manual labor. Today, all but one of these ancient wonders have vanished. The Great Pyramid of Giza     Completed around 2560 B.C., Egypt's Great Pyramid is also the only one of the seven ancient wonders that exist today. When it was finished, the pyramid had a smooth exterior and reached a height of 481 feet. Archaeologists say it took as long as 20 years to build the Great Pyramid, which is thought to have been built to honor the Pharoah Khufu.
